public static class ParsedBinaryRange.ParsedBucket extends ParsedMultiBucketAggregation.ParsedBucket implements Range.Bucket
MultiBucketsAggregation.Bucket.SubAggregationComparator<B extends MultiBucketsAggregation.Bucket>
ToXContent.DelegatingMapParams, ToXContent.MapParams, ToXContent.Params
EMPTY_PARAMS
Constructor and Description |
---|
ParsedBucket() |
Modifier and Type | Method and Description |
---|---|
java.lang.Object |
getFrom() |
java.lang.String |
getFromAsString() |
java.lang.Object |
getKey() |
java.lang.String |
getKeyAsString() |
java.lang.Object |
getTo() |
java.lang.String |
getToAsString() |
XContentBuilder |
toXContent(XContentBuilder builder,
ToXContent.Params params) |
getAggregations, getDocCount, isKeyed, keyToXContent, parseXContent, setAggregations, setDocCount, setKeyAsString, setKeyed
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
getAggregations, getDocCount
isFragment
public java.lang.Object getKey()
getKey
in interface MultiBucketsAggregation.Bucket
public java.lang.String getKeyAsString()
getKeyAsString
in interface MultiBucketsAggregation.Bucket
getKeyAsString
in class ParsedMultiBucketAggregation.ParsedBucket
public java.lang.Object getFrom()
getFrom
in interface Range.Bucket
public java.lang.String getFromAsString()
getFromAsString
in interface Range.Bucket
public java.lang.Object getTo()
getTo
in interface Range.Bucket
public java.lang.String getToAsString()
getToAsString
in interface Range.Bucket
public XContentBuilder toXContent(XContentBuilder builder, ToXContent.Params params) throws java.io.IOException
toXContent
in interface ToXContent
toXContent
in class ParsedMultiBucketAggregation.ParsedBucket
java.io.IOException